Abstract

A varnish for forming a liquid crystal alignment layer is prepared by formulating a polymer obtained by using a silsesquioxane derivative represented by the formula (1), and a solvent. In the formula (1), R independently represents an unsubstituted phenyl, cyclopentyl, cyclohexyl, or t-butyl group, and Yindependently represents a group selected from the following formulae (a-1) to (a-6).
